Output 8a31a68ea2f76f42e97d5e62de9b63e35ae8ae64982268f229754809e337d6c9:1

value
25993394309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af39cf0c1dbc773641713726241bd1e82f46b8ef OP_EQUAL
address
3HfXRjnLh9EM1JzeMPRTVTP8pUSLFDV8q7
transaction
8a31a68ea2f76f42e97d5e62de9b63e35ae8ae64982268f229754809e337d6c9
spent
true